请详细说明如何搭建MySQL数据库环境,并演示创建一个数据库及其中的表,并实现基本的CRUD(创建、读取、更新、删除)操作。
时间: 2024-12-09 18:28:07 浏览: 12
为了全面掌握MySQL数据库的搭建和基础操作,推荐参考《全面掌握MySQL:黑马技术总结要点》。该资源总结了MySQL从安装配置到数据管理的全过程,有助于你建立起坚实的数据库管理基础。
参考资源链接:[全面掌握MySQL:黑马技术总结要点](https://wenku.csdn.net/doc/69qpuikvmn?spm=1055.2569.3001.10343)
首先,你需要在你的系统上安装MySQL。根据你的操作系统不同,安装过程也会有所不同,但一般步骤包括下载安装包、解压、初始化数据库、设置环境变量和启动MySQL服务。
安装完成后,通过MySQL的命令行客户端或者其他图形界面工具(如phpMyAdmin),你可以登录MySQL服务器。接着,根据业务需求创建一个新的数据库,例如名为`testdb`。创建数据库的SQL语句如下:
```sql
CREATE DATABASE testdb;
```
使用`USE`语句选择当前操作的数据库:
```sql
USE testdb;
```
然后,你可以创建一个表。假设我们需要一个存储用户信息的表,名为`users`,可以使用以下SQL语句:
```sql
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50) NOT NULL,
password VARCHAR(50) NOT NULL,
email VARCHAR(100),
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);
```
接下来,进行基本的CRUD操作:
创建(Create)一个新用户:
```sql
INSERT INTO users (username, password, email) VALUES ('newuser', 'newpass', '***');
```
读取(Read)表中的所有用户信息:
```sql
SELECT * FROM users;
```
更新(Update)某个用户的信息,例如修改邮箱地址:
```sql
UPDATE users SET email = '***' WHERE id = 1;
```
删除(Delete)某个用户:
```sql
DELETE FROM users WHERE id = 1;
```
通过以上步骤,你已经完成了从安装MySQL到执行基本数据库操作的全过程。掌握这些操作对于后续进行更复杂的数据库管理与优化至关重要。如果你希望深入学习MySQL的高级特性以及最佳实践,建议继续探索《全面掌握MySQL:黑马技术总结要点》,它将为你提供更广泛的知识点和实战案例。
参考资源链接:[全面掌握MySQL:黑马技术总结要点](https://wenku.csdn.net/doc/69qpuikvmn?spm=1055.2569.3001.10343)
阅读全文